CEBU CITY — The National Union of Journalists of the Philippines (NUJP) Cebu chapter has called for adherence to ethical practices in journalism following a controversial incident involving a local teacher and a media practitioner.
The incident, which has sparked significant debate on social media, occurred after the teacher was accused of assaulting two minor students on Aug. 31, 2024.
